Indymedia: Your Source For News On M30.
Potentially, thousands of workers will take to the streets of the country next Monday. Indymedia and DCTV are pooling resources to cover the day and are calling for you, the readership, to contribute your reports, photographs and videos to compile an accurate grassroots account of what could be a significant date in this latest round of the struggle for workers’ rights and social justice.

March 30, next Monday, has been named by ICTU as the day the public sector unions will close up shop and shut the country down, in protest against the imposition of the ‘pensions levy’ and the failure to honour recent pay agreements. However, private sector workers are also looking for an occasion to vent their anger and it is likely that the one-day shut down will receive some significant support from this quarter too.

Several affiliated unions have successfully balloted their members to support a walk out; the country's largest craft union the Technical Engineering and Electrical Union is to serve notice to the government and employers today. Meanwhile IMPACT, Ireland's largest public-sector trade union, has voted not to take part in M30. Sixty-five per cent of the membership voted to take part in the demonstration, however a 66% majority is needed to carry industrial action. The union's executive will meet tomorrow to consider the options.
